Wireless industrial Ethernet – 2,4 GHz and beyond.

Wireless Ethernet in the popular 2,4 GHz band is becoming crowded. For the typical home and office user the occasional loss in signal is tolerable, but for industrial applications this is often unacceptable.

What is the solution? Firstly, do not underestimate the value of proper planning. Most WLAN bands have several channels and selecting an unused channel is an important step in avoiding interfering signals. However, the established 2,4 GHz band has become so crowded that this is sometimes not possible. And it is not only WLAN devices that are using the 2,4 GHz band – items such as cordless telephones and Bluetooth devices are often contending for the same space.

Other options include migrating to a less congested frequency band. Wireless industrial-grade Ethernet modems in different frequency bands with various throughput options are being offered by Elpro Technologies:

* Elpro 805U-E Wireless Ethernet Modem (869 MHz/76,8 Kbits/s): This modem is ideal for applications with relatively low throughput requirements (eg, PLCs, scada) and is well-suited for non line-of-sight applications. Up to 5 km range.

* Elpro 240U-E/245U-E Wireless Ethernet Modem (2,4 GHz/54 Mbits/s/ IEEE 802.11b/g): Widely used modem, ideal for extending and integrating into existing 2,4 GHz WLAN links, and has a good distance/speed trade off.

* Elpro 245U-E-A Wireless Ethernet Modem (5 GHz/108 Mbits/s/IEEE 802.11a): High speed – ideal for industrial video applications and for use as a wireless backbone. More channels than 802.11b/g (non-overlapping) and is a relatively unused band. Allowable power of up to 1 W.
